The launch of Sanlam Fintech – a business cluster within the Sanlam Group – signals a strategic move to expand the Group’s existing fintech offering and ensure that all aspects of the US$8-billion (R143-billion) listed company's services are digitally-led.
The 2023 South African Loyalty Awards took place on 14 September, awarding SA’s top loyalty rewards programmes and initiatives. Up against well-established players such as FNB’s eBucks and Clicks ClubCard, it is a significant achievement that Sanlam Rewards’ Wealth Bonus loyalty programme was Commended by judges.
Sanlam today reported a strong financial performance for the first half of 2023, saying the group’s earnings pattern was back on track after a series of what management described as one-in-25 or one-in-100-year events between 2020 to 2022, highlighted by the Covid-19 pandemic.
